Research is Key
Before diving into the world of storage auctions, it’s important to conduct thorough research. Start by identifying reputable auction companies in your area. Check their websites or give them a call to find out about upcoming events. Additionally, familiarize yourself with the local laws and regulations governing storage auctions to ensure that you are operating within legal boundaries.
Next, take advantage of online resources such as auction listing websites or social media groups dedicated to storage auctions. These platforms often provide detailed information about upcoming auctions, including unit photos and descriptions. By doing your research beforehand, you can gain valuable insights into the potential value of each unit and make more informed bidding decisions.
Develop a Budget
One common mistake made by newcomers to storage auctions is getting caught up in the excitement of bidding without setting a budget first. To maximize your profits, it’s essential to develop a clear budget that outlines how much you are willing to spend on each unit.
Consider not only the initial bid price but also any additional expenses that may arise after winning an auction. This can include costs associated with transporting or cleaning out the unit. By being mindful of these potential expenses upfront, you can better assess whether a particular unit is worth bidding on or not.
Assessing Unit Value
When attending a storage auction in your area, it’s crucial to quickly assess the value of each unit. While you may not have a chance to inspect the contents thoroughly, you can still make educated guesses based on visible cues. Look for signs of quality items such as furniture, appliances, or electronics. Pay attention to labeled boxes or any indications of collectibles or antiques.
However, it’s important to remember that not all units will yield valuable items. Some may contain mostly junk or outdated items. To minimize risks and maximize profits, consider bidding conservatively on units with uncertain value.
Selling Your Findings
Once you’ve successfully won a storage auction and uncovered some treasures, the next step is to sell them for a profit. There are various avenues you can explore when it comes to selling your findings.
Online platforms such as eBay, Craigslist, or Facebook Marketplace offer convenient ways to reach potential buyers in your area. These platforms also give you the flexibility to set your own prices and negotiate with interested parties.
If you have particularly valuable items or collectibles, consider reaching out to local antique dealers or consignment shops that specialize in those specific items. They may be able to provide expert advice on pricing and help connect you with potential buyers.
